static void
SDL_FillRect4(Uint8 * pixels, int pitch, Uint32 color, int w, int h)
{
while (h--) {
SDL_memset4(pixels, color, w);
pixels += pitch;
}
}
/*
* This function performs a fast fill of the given rectangle with 'color'
*/
int
SDL_FillRect(SDL_Surface * dst, const SDL_Rect * rect, Uint32 color)
{
SDL_Rect clipped;
Uint8 *pixels;
if (!dst) {
return SDL_SetError("Passed NULL destination surface");
}
/* This function doesn't work on surfaces < 8 bpp */
if (dst->format->BitsPerPixel < 8) {
return SDL_SetError("SDL_FillRect(): Unsupported surface format");
}
/* If 'rect' == NULL, then fill the whole surface */
if (rect) {
/* Perform clipping */
if (!SDL_IntersectRect(rect, &dst->clip_rect, &clipped)) {
return 0;
}
rect = &clipped;
} else {
rect = &dst->clip_rect;
}
/* Perform software fill */
if (!dst->pixels) {
return SDL_SetError("SDL_FillRect(): You must lock the surface");
}
pixels = (Uint8 *) dst->pixels + rect->y * dst->pitch +
rect->x * dst->format->BytesPerPixel;
switch (dst->format->BytesPerPixel) {
case 1:
{
color |= (color << 8);
color |= (color << 16);
#ifdef __SSE__
if (SDL_HasSSE()) {
SDL_FillRect1SSE(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
#endif
#ifdef __MMX__
if (SDL_HasMMX()) {
SDL_FillRect1MMX(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
#endif
SDL_FillRect1(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
case 2:
{
color |= (color << 16);
#ifdef __SSE__
if (SDL_HasSSE()) {
SDL_FillRect2SSE(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
#endif
#ifdef __MMX__
if (SDL_HasMMX()) {
SDL_FillRect2MMX(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
#endif
SDL_FillRect2(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
case 3:
/* 24-bit RGB is a slow path, at least for now. */
{
SDL_FillRect3(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
case 4:
{
#ifdef __SSE__
if (SDL_HasSSE()) {
SDL_FillRect4SSE(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
#endif
#ifdef __MMX__
if (SDL_HasMMX()) {
SDL_FillRect4MMX(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
#endif
SDL_FillRect4(pixels, dst->pitch, color, rect->w, rect->h);
break;
}
}
/* We're done! */
return 0;
}
int
SDL_FillRects(SDL_Surface * dst, const SDL_Rect * rects, int count,
Uint32 color)
{
int i;
int status = 0;
if (!rects) {
return SDL_SetError("SDL_FillRects() passed NULL rects");
}
for (i = 0; i < count; ++i) {
status += SDL_FillRect(dst, &rects[i], color);
}
return status;
}
